Texas anti-bullying laws also prohibit cyberbullying. “Cyberbullying” is bullying that is done through the use of any electronic device, including through the use of a cellphone, camera, e-mail, instant messaging, text messaging, social media, a website, or any other Internet-based communication tool. The Texas Constitution, in Article I, sections 8 and 27 protects the “liberty to speak, write or publish … opinions on any subject,” and “the right … to assemble. YOUR RIGHTS IN GENERAL These provisions protect your right to march, leaflet, parade, picket, circulate petitions and ask for signatures, and other forms of peaceful protest. We reviewed the 2022-2023 dress codes of 1,178 of Texas’ 1,207 K-12 public school districts and found that: 53% of surveyed districts force students to follow dress codes rooted in outdated gender norms and stereotypes, including boys-only hair length rules and other rules that only apply to girls. EL PASO, Texas — Today, Texas abortion providers — led by Whole Woman’s Health — along with several abortion funds, practical support networks, doctors, health center staff, and clergy members filed a lawsuit to block a radical new Texas law ...The Harms of Border Patrol on Daily Life Along the Texas Border. In Texas border communities, Border Patrol agents are everywhere: schools, hospitals, grocery stores, and other public spaces. Between September 2021 and May 2022, the ACLU of Texas interviewed 152 people living in the Rio Grande Valley. Dec 19, 2023 · AUSTIN, Texas — The American Civil Liberties Union, the ACLU of Texas, and the Texas Civil Rights Project (TCRP) filed a lawsuit today challenging Texas Senate Bill 4, which would permit local and state law enforcement to arrest and detain people they suspect to have entered Texas from another country without federal authorization. She is currently based in San Antonio but was born and raised in the Rio Grande Valley.Sarah’s experience is rooted in community-based work and immigration policy and advocacy, and as a border native, she has spent a few years focusing on asylum and …Aug 29, 2022 · The ACLU of Texas and partners are challenging the validity of the pre-Roe statutes in the courts. On June 28, 2022, a judge in Harris County sided with abortion providers and issued a temporary restraining order blocking any prosecutions under the pre-Roe statutes.
